UML顺序图规范

本文详细介绍了UML交互图中的关键元素,包括生命线(通常为虚线)、消息(创始消息与同步消息的区分)、控制期(表示阻塞调用)、返回值、自身消息、创建与销毁对象的表示方法、图框操作符(如alt、loop和opt)以及异步消息。此外,还提到了调用类静态方法的表示以及如何在关联交互图中引用其他图。
摘要由CSDN通过智能技术生成

1 生命线

一般为虚线

2 消息

(1)创始消息
实心圆开头,实心箭头
(2)同步消息
实心箭头

3 控制期

表示阻塞调用

4 返回值

5 自身消息

6 创建实例

虚线实心箭头,新创建的对象实例画在创建时的高度上

7 销毁对象

用<<destroy>>和X表示对象的销毁

8 图框

常见的图框操作符:
alt:选择性的片段,用于表示保护信息表达的互斥逻辑。
loop:用于表示保护信息为真的循环片段。loop(n)指明循环的次数。
opt:当保护信息为真时执行的可选片段。
(1)循环,loop
(2)有条件消息,opt
当满足条件时,执行图框内操作
(3)互斥的有条件消息,alt
(4)嵌套图框

9 调用类的静态方法 

以元类表示类对象

10 关联交互图

引用某个sd图时,使用ref图框

11异步消息

之前说明同步消息是实心箭头,对应的异步消息是刺心箭头。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值